AWS使用Ubuntu 22.04启动新实例:映像的卷超出了实例允许的数量

2024-03-31

AWS 使用 Ubuntu 22.04 启动新实例:

The selected AMI contains more instance store volumes 
than the instance allows. Only the first 0 instance
store volumes from the AMI will be accessible from the 
instance

这是什么意思? AMI 有卷吗?


EC2 实例可以有两种基本类型的卷: EBS (弹性块存储 https://aws.amazon.com/ebs/) and 实例存储 https://docs.aws.amazon.com/AWSEC2/latest/UserGuide/InstanceStorage.html. 本文 https://aws.amazon.com/premiumsupport/knowledge-center/instance-store-vs-ebs/阐明了差异,但简而言之,EBS 卷是独立于实例的网络附加存储,而实例存储卷是非持久性的本地块存储卷(例如,当实例终止时,实例存储卷会丢失) )。

您询问 AMI 是否有卷。基本上是一个 AMIis一卷或多卷。 AMI 是处于特定状态的磁盘的快照。如今,大多数现代 AMI 使用 EBS 存储作为根卷;也就是说,包含实例启动的操作系统内核的卷。使用实例存储作为根卷过去很常见,但 EBS 已经变得几乎与实例存储一样快、更安全、更可靠,因此实例存储卷的用例正在减少。

话虽如此,我对您看到此错误感到非常惊讶。该错误消息表明 AMI 包含实例存储,但您选择的实例类型不支持实例存储(许多实例类型不支持)。但是,所有 Ubuntu 22.04 AMI 都使用 EBS,而不是实例存储。如果您使用Ubuntu Amazon EC2 AMI 定位器 https://cloud-images.ubuntu.com/locator/ec2/然后搜索“22.04”,你会发现所有的结果都有hvm:ebs-ssd作为实例类型。只有非常旧的 Ubuntu AMI 才有实例存储卷。

确保您使用 AMI 定位器来查找 Ubuntu 22.04 AMI。这些 AMI 应适用于大多数或所有 EC2 实例类型。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

AWS使用Ubuntu 22.04启动新实例:映像的卷超出了实例允许的数量 的相关文章

  • EC2 t2.medium 可爆发信用“储蓄”计算

    我正在使用 T2 medium 实例 一天的三分之一的时间我都在做密集的统计计算 并计算出剩下的 2 3 的时间我将以每小时 24 小时的速度 赚取 学分 但这并没有发生 这是我这两天的使用情况 这是我的信用账户 直到昨天下午 6 点我已经
  • AWS - t2.micro 实例 EBS 卷大小

    我试图通过 AWS 控制台创建 t2 micro 实例 我希望它免费一年 但它不附带任何实例存储 所以我想在这个实例中添加 EBS 卷 免费吗 我可以在 t2 micro 中免费添加的最大 EBS 卷是多少 Model vCPU CPU C
  • 如何以编程方式获取亚马逊卖家中心订单?

    我们一直手动将亚马逊订单输入我们的系统 并希望将其自动化 但是 我似乎不知道该怎么做 他们的文档几乎不存在 有 亚马逊库存管理 AIM API 用于管理订单和库存 事件通知服务 ENS API 获取订单通知 卖家中心 SOAP API 上传
  • 使用 AWS CodeDeploy 的环境变量

    我有一个 Web 应用程序 它利用环境变量进行某些配置 数据库凭据 API 密钥等 我目前正在使用 Elastic Beanstalk 进行部署 并且可以在 AWS 中轻松设置这些 这很棒 因为我的代码库中没有这些敏感数据 不过 我正在考虑
  • Amplify 的completeNewPassword 方法针对用户数据抛出 TypeError

    我尝试将自定义 UI 与 aws Amplify 结合使用 但遇到了 Auth completeNewPassword 问题 任何使用此方法的尝试都会引发错误Error in v on handler TypeError Cannot re
  • 如何在 AWS CloudWatch 中解析混合文本和 JSON 日志条目以进行日志指标筛选

    我正在尝试解析文本和 JSON 混合的日志条目 第一行是文本表示 接下来的行是事件的 JSON 负载 可能的示例之一是 2016 07 24T21 08 07 888Z INFO Command completed lessonrecord
  • 如何使用 pyspark 从 s3 存储桶读取 csv 文件

    我正在使用 Apache Spark 3 1 0 和 Python 3 9 6 我正在尝试从 AWS S3 存储桶读取 csv 文件 如下所示 spark SparkSession builder getOrCreate file s3 b
  • RDS不支持创建以下组合的数据库实例

    我正在尝试弄清楚如何创建一个简单的数据库实例 到目前为止我只有一个DBSubnetGroup and DBInstance 此时 根据我尝试使用模板 在 Designer 中创建 创建堆栈时遇到的错误 我已经弄清楚了一些事情 我现在遇到了一
  • 保护 AWS API 网关的安全

    我们有一个现有的应用程序 并且正在开发 AWS 中的应用程序所需的新 API 我们希望对 AWS API 启用基于角色的访问控制 而无需将用户迁移到 AWS Cognito 我们认为我们可能需要使用开发人员身份提供商和 IAM 角色 但不确
  • 从 boto3 调用 AWS Glue Pythonshell 作业时出现参数错误

    基于上一篇文章 https stackoverflow com questions 58044032 retrieving s3 path from payload inside aws glue pythonshell job 58044
  • 图片上传亚马逊s3 android SDK 2.0

    我想将图像上传到 android 中的亚马逊 s3 存储桶 我没有收到任何错误 但它不起作用有人可以帮助我吗 我找不到任何关于此的好的例子或问题 我将图像分配给 文件图像3 images3 new File uri getPath publ
  • 如何使用 AWS CLI 列出用户及其权限?

    我运行这个命令 aws iam list users 我得到了用户列表 但没有列出权限 意味着如果某人是 root 或 s3fullaccess 等 我运行另一个命令 aws iam list user policies user name
  • AWS RDS 如何设置 MySQL 数据库

    我有一个 Java 应用程序成功运行在Amazon Web Services Elastic Beanstalk 我正在尝试设置MySQL 我已经创建了一个数据库实例 如您所见 问题一 如何将我的 Java 应用程序连接到数据库 我有以下代
  • 使用 PHP SDK 在亚马逊 S3 上上传文件

    我正在尝试通过 PHP SDK 在我的亚马逊 S3 存储桶上上传文件 但是我的脚本不起作用 我有一个空白页面 没有任何错误或异常消息 编辑 在 php ini 中启用 display error 后 我有下面的错误消息 看起来 sdk 在我
  • 无法在 AWS Lambda 上使用请求模块

    我需要在每天运行一次的 python 脚本中进行休息调用 我无法使用 AWS Lambda 将 requests 包打包到我的 python 包中 我收到错误 无法导入模块 lambda function 没有名为 lambda funct
  • AWS Step Functions 中的直通输入到输出

    我怎样才能将输入传递给TaskAWS Step Functions 中的状态到输出 读完后输入和输出处理 http docs aws amazon com step functions latest dg amazon states lan
  • Lambda函数检查特定标签是否不存在-​​python

    我正在尝试以下内容 获取满足以下任一条件的所有 EC2 实例 被标记为标签所有者和值未知或未知 缺少标签所有者 我能够完成 1 但不知道如何实现 2 import boto3 import collections import dateti
  • 如何在亚马逊云(AWS EC2)中安装firefox?

    我有一个拥有所有权限的 AWS 账户 我想在环境中安装 Firefox 因为我的应用程序将启动 Firefox 并对 Web 应用程序运行一些测试 如何安装火狐浏览器 执行以下命令解决了问题 sudo apt get install xvf
  • 禁用进度输出 aws s3sync 而不禁用所有输出

    有什么办法可以禁用 Completed 1 of 12 part s with 11 file s remaining 进度输出aws s3 sync命令 来自 aws cli 工具 我知道有一个 quiet选项 但我不想使用它 因为我仍然
  • IAM 允许用户访问某个区域上 ec2 的所有内容

    我试图允许一个用户对 us west 2 执行所有操作 这是我的政策 Version 2012 10 17 Statement Effect Allow Action ec2 Resource arn aws ec2 us west 2 8

随机推荐